#include <vector>
#include <string>
#include <boost/property_map.hpp>
#ifdef BOOST_NO_STD_ITERATOR_TRAITS
#error This examples requires a compiler that provides a working std::iterator_traits
#endif
namespace foo
{
using namespace boost;
template < class RandomAccessIterator, class IndexMap >
class iterator_property_map:public boost::put_get_helper <
typename std::iterator_traits < RandomAccessIterator >::reference,
iterator_property_map < RandomAccessIterator, IndexMap > >
{
public:
typedef std::ptrdiff_t key_type;
typedef typename std::iterator_traits < RandomAccessIterator >::value_type
value_type;
typedef typename std::iterator_traits < RandomAccessIterator >::reference
reference;
typedef boost::lvalue_property_map_tag category;
iterator_property_map(RandomAccessIterator cc = RandomAccessIterator(),
const IndexMap & _id =
IndexMap()):iter(cc), index(_id)
{
}
reference operator[] (std::ptrdiff_t v) const
{
return *(iter + get(index, v));
}
protected:
RandomAccessIterator iter;
IndexMap index;
};
}
int
main()
{
typedef std::vector < std::string > vec_t;
typedef foo::iterator_property_map < vec_t::iterator,
boost::identity_property_map > pmap_t;
using namespace boost;
function_requires < Mutable_LvaluePropertyMapConcept < pmap_t, int > >();
return 0;
}
